Government Description
The lrdr will provide persistent discrimination capability to the ballistic missile defense system to support the defense of the homeland. Additional work includes development, deployment, testing, and operation of the lrdr, production of front end electronics hardware to meet radar objective capability, and software improvements for configuration 2 development (increment 6C/7). The contract also covers electronic protection test phase activities, sustainment spares, and continued systems development, sustainment, and test support for lrdr.

DOD Announcements
Oct 2015:
Lockheed Martin Corp., Moorestown, New Jersey, is being awarded a $784,289,883 fixed-price incentive contract with options to develop, deploy, test, and operate a Long Range Discrimination Radar (LRDR). The LRDR will provide persistent discrimination capability to the Ballistic Missile Defense system to support the defense of the homeland. Work will be performed in Moorestown, New Jersey; and at Clear Air Force Station, Alaska. The period of performance is Oct. 21, 2015 through Jan. 21, 2024. Fiscal 2015 research, development, test and evaluation funds in the amount of $35,500,000 are being obligated at time of award. This contract was a competitively awarded acquisition with three offers received. The Missile Defense Agency, Huntsville, Alabama, is the contracting activity (HQ0147-16-C-0011).
Aug 2017: Lockheed Martin Corp., Rotary and Mission Systems Division, Moorestown, New Jersey, is being awarded a $9,451,695 modification (P00040) to previously awarded fixed-price incentive contract HQ0147-16-C-0011. The modification brings the total cumulative value of the contract to $681,880,588 from $672,428,893. This modification provides for development efforts associated with quantifying discrimination performance and evolving threats. Work will be performed at Moorestown, New Jersey, with an expected completion date of February 2019. Missile Defense Agency fiscal 2016 research, development, test, and evaluation funds in the amount of $5,269,400 will be obligated at time of award. The Missile Defense Agency, Huntsville, Alabama, is the contracting activity (HQ0147-16-C-0011).

Mar 2018: Lockheed Martin Corp., Rotary and Mission Systems Division, Moorestown, New Jersey, is being awarded an $8,457,694 modification (P00054) to previously awarded fixed-price incentive contract HQ0147-16-C-0011. The modification brings the total cumulative face value of the contract to $695,874,878 from $687,417,184. This modification provides for the production of additional front end electronics hardware towards meeting the radar's objective capability as defined in the specification. This also avoids post deployment retrofit integration costs. Work will be performed at the Lockheed Martin facility in Moorestown, New Jersey, as well as their subcontractors' facilities at various locations, with an expected completion date of September 2020. Missile Defense Agency fiscal 2018 research, development, test, and evaluation funds in the amount of $6,500,000 will be obligated at time of award. The Missile Defense Agency, Huntsville, Alabama, is the contracting activity (HQ0147-16-C-0011).

Sep 2021: Lockheed Martin Corp., Moorestown, New Jersey, is being awarded a $96,722,234 modification (P00134) to a previously awarded contract (HQ0147-16-C-0011) for cost-plus-incentive-fee contract line item number 7000 for Configuration 2 Development (Increment 6C/7) software improvements, and cost-plus-fixed-fee option contract line item number 8000 for Electronic Protection Test Phase 1. The modification brings the total cumulative face value of the contract to $1,105,983,997 from $1,009,261,764. The work will be performed in Moorestown, New Jersey; and Clear, Alaska. The period of performance is from Sept. 17, 2021, through July 31, 2024. Fiscal 2021 research, development, test and evaluation funds in the amount of $43,718,6165 are being obligated on this award. The Missile Defense Agency, Redstone Arsenal, Alabama, is the contracting activity.
Jun 2024: Lockheed Martin Corp., Moorestown, New Jersey, is being awarded a noncompetitive, cost-plus-incentive-fee, and cost-plus-fixed-fee contract with a total value of $122,449,643. Under this contract extension, Lockheed Martin will continue systems development, sustainment, and test support of the Long-Range Discrimination Radar. The work will be performed in Moorestown, New Jersey; and Clear, Alaska. The performance period is July 1, 2024, to March 31, 2027. Fiscal 2024 research, development, test and evaluation funds in the amount of $122,449,643 are being obligated on this award. The Missile Defense Agency, Redstone Arsenal, Alabama, is the contracting activity (HQ0147-16-C-0011).
Nov 2024: Lockheed Martin Corp., Moorestown, New Jersey, is being awarded a noncompetitive, firm-fixed-price contract with a total value of $9,325,795. Under this contract, Lockheed Martin will provide sustainment spares in support of the Long-Range Discrimination Radar. The work will be performed in Moorestown, New Jersey; Clearwater Florida; and Clear, Alaska. The performance period is Nov. 22, 2024, to March 31, 2027. Fiscal 2024 and 2025 research, design, test and evaluation funds in the amount of $5,443,443; and fiscal 2025 operations and maintenance funds in the amount of $3,882,352, are being obligated on this award. The Missile Defense Agency, Redstone Arsenal, Alabama, is the contracting activity (HQ0147-16-C-0011).
